> > This patchset is to support the RTC provided by the Maxim 8998 chip. For
> > this first, needs i2c interface changes and interrupts support of
> > max8998 mfd driver.
> >
> > Changes since v1:
> > - Fix missing braces of 3/3 patch from v1 review.
> > - The rest is same with v1.
> >
> > Changes since v2:
> > - add missing free_irq and rtc_valid_tm on rtc driver of 3/3 patch
> > - The rest is same with v2.
> >
> > Joonyoung Shim (3):
> > mfd: MAX8998: Use struct i2c_client to argument on i2c operation functions
> > mfd: MAX8998: Add interrupts support
> > rtc: Add MAX8998 rtc driver
